What a Gem! Neighborhood Park and RIHEL Alumna
On October 29, 2015, the the historic Denver Mestizo-Curtis Park was honored as a Neighborhood Gem at the 2015 Mayor’s Design Award ceremony. The effort to redevelop and revitalize this park can be credited in large part to the leadereship of Geraldolyn Horton-Harris (ALTP 2014 & LHCD 2015).
In addition to this most recent award, Geraldolyn has received multiple recognitions in connection with her work on the park, including personal acknowledgements from both a Denver Council Member and the Mayor, and a surprise award from the Black Arts Council during an official playground opening ribbon cutting in July of 2015.
The Mestizo-Curtis Park project was also selected as a City Parks Alliance 2015 Frontline Park, and has been highlighted by the Trust for Public Land. An OpEd piece by Dottie Lamm provides an excellent tribute to Geraldolyn’s collaborative and inclusive leadership style. Well done!
